Navigating Menopause's Effects on Weight: A Guide to Healthy Habits

As women transition through menopause, hormonal shifts can lead to changes in weight distribution, often resulting in weight gain particularly around the midsection. While these changes are normal, there are steps you can take to manage your weight and feel confident throughout this life stage.

Firstly, focus on a balanced diet rich in fruits, vegetables, whole grains, and lean protein. Limit processed foods, as they tend to contribute to weight gain. Staying hydrated throughout the day can also help curb cravings and support energy levels.

Incorporate regular exercise into your routine. Aim for at Menopause and Cholesterol Management least 30 minutes of moderate-intensity exercise most days of the week. Activities like brisk walking, swimming, or cycling can be particularly beneficial.

  • Get enough sleep: Aim for 7-8 hours per night to help regulate hormones and reduce stress, which can contribute to weight gain.
  • Manage stress effectively through techniques like meditation or deep breathing exercises.
  • Consult with your doctor or a registered dietitian for personalized guidance and support on weight management during menopause.

Remember, menopause is a natural transition. By embracing healthy habits, you can manage your weight effectively throughout this stage of life.
